日韩天天综合网_野战两个奶头被亲到高潮_亚洲日韩欧美精品综合_av女人天堂污污污_视频一区**字幕无弹窗_国产亚洲欧美小视频_国内性爱精品在线免费视频_国产一级电影在线播放_日韩欧美内地福利_亚洲一二三不卡片区

CSS二列寬度自適應_Div+CSS教程

編輯Tag賺U幣

從二列固定寬度入手,開始嘗試二列布局的情況下,左右欄寬度能夠做到自適應,從一列自適應布局中我們知道,設(shè)定自適應主要通過寬度的百分比值設(shè)置,因此在二列寬度自適應的布局中也同樣是對百分比寬度值的設(shè)計,繼續(xù)上面的CSS代碼,我們得新定義二列的寬度值:

#left {
    background-color: #E8F5FE;
    border: 1px solid #A9C9E2;
    float: left;
    height: 300px;
    width: 20%;
}
#right {
    background-color: #F2FDDB;
    border: 1px solid #A5CF3D;
    float: left;
    height: 300px;
    width: 70%;
}

左欄寬度設(shè)置為寬度20%,右欄寬度設(shè)置為寬度的70%,看上去像一個左側(cè)為導航,右側(cè)為內(nèi)容的常見網(wǎng)頁形式。

 

本文來源與模板無憂_hl5o.cn 模板無憂_hl5o.cn

 

為什么沒有將右欄設(shè)置為80%,從而實現(xiàn)整體100%的效果?
這個問題的原因還得從對象的其它屬性說起,大家應該還記得,為了使布局在預覽中更清楚,我們使用了border屬性,使得兩個對象都具有1px的邊框,而在CSS布局中,一個對象的寬度,不僅僅由width值來決定,一個對象的真實寬度是由對象本身的寬、對象的左右邊距,以及左右邊框,還有內(nèi)邊距這些屬性相加而成,因此左面的對象不僅僅是瀏覽器窗口的20%的寬度,還應該加上左邊的邊框的寬度。這樣算下來左右欄都超出了自身的百分比寬度,最終的寬度也超過了瀏覽器窗口的寬度,因此右欄將被擠掉第二行顯示,從而失去了左右分欄的效果,因此這里使用了并非100%的寬度之和,而在實際應用之中,可以通過避免邊框及邊距的使用,而達到左右與瀏覽器填滿的效果。這樣一個有關(guān)寬度計算的問題,是CSS布局中相當重要的被稱為為盒模型的問題,在以后的教程中會詳細講解,請繼續(xù)關(guān)注本站的教程。
本例的制作過程和CSS網(wǎng)頁布局入門教程4:二列固定寬度一樣,只不過在設(shè)置寬度時把固定的固定的200px寬度分別換成20%和70%,在此不再贅述。
 

 

來源:模板無憂//所屬分類:Div+CSS教程/更新時間:2012-07-24
相關(guān)Div+CSS教程